New versions of Zevra (v1.8.4).
https://github.com/sovaz1997/Zevra/rele ... 1.8.4_r650
The elo gain is about 60 points in LTC. Changes in Multi-Cut and moves generator optimizations.
Code: Select all
tc=60+0.6 (LTC)
Hash=16
Score of Zevra v1.8.4 r650 vs Zevra v1.8.3 r636: 347 - 204 - 257 [0.588] 808
Elo difference: 62.14 +/- 19.94
---------------------------
tc=60+0.6 (LTC)
Hash=16
Score of Zevra v1.8.4 r650 vs Zevra v1.8.1 r594 popcnt: 704 - 268 - 394 [0.660] 1366
Elo difference: 114.91 +/- 16.01
---------------------------
tc=10+0.1 (STC)
Hash=16
Score of Zevra Zevra v1.8.4 r650 vs Zevra v1.8.1 r594 popcnt: 648 - 292 - 260 [0.648] 1200
Elo difference: 106.27 +/- 17.97

New release of Zevra: Zevra v1.8.5. Improved recognition of three-fold repetition of the position, added estimates of mg-eg for pawns, minor changes in the search.
The gain is approximately 20-30 points in 60+0.6.
Code: Select all
tc=60m+0.6s
hash=64mb
Score of Zevra v1.8.5 r664 vs Zevra v1.8.4 r650: 638 - 521 - 459 [0.536] 1618
Elo difference: 25.17 +/- 14.34
